A good afternoon crafting - first of all some really cute thank-you cards for my kids to send to relatives.  The ones in the left hand corner are courtesy of Mary-Anne and are super cute!  They have matching envelopes and are a really sweet size.  I have used an image from the Silhouette library designed by Lori Whitlock for the other thank you notes and added the image to make matching envelopes - both cards brilliant for batch-making.


My daughter asked me if I could make her a card for her friend's birthday so I thought, make one card, might as well make two:  I was in the mood by now :)  Only thing is, I really should listen to the customer brief - she said pink and black but somehow I heard red and black....I made matching envelopes by sticking a bit of the black flourish paper inside the envelope and cut a couple of strips of scalloped card for the outside edge, it makes a difference I think to have the envelope to match.
